Is unlawful competitive bidding a felony or a misdemeanor in Indiana?
It depends on the circumstances: unlawful competitive bidding ranges from a Class C Infraction to a Class A Misdemeanor in Indiana under Ind. Code § 35-44.2-2-4.
Unlawful competitive bidding — base offense: Class C Infraction (Ind. Code § 35-44.2-2-4(b)) · Unlawful competitive bidding — knowing/intentional with prior conviction: Class A Misdemeanor (Ind. Code § 35-44.2-2-4(b))
